/** @file invocation-trail.hpp
|
|
** A command in preparation of being issued from the UI.
|
|
** The actual persistent operations on the session model are defined
|
|
** as DSL scripts acting on the session interface, and configured as a
|
|
** _command prototype_. Typically these need to be enriched with at least
|
|
** the actual subject to invoke this command on; many commands require
|
|
** additional parameters, e.g. some time or colour value. These actual
|
|
** invocation parameters need to be picked up from UI elements, and the
|
|
** process of preparing and outfitting a generic command with these
|
|
** actual values is tracked by an [InvocationTrail] handle. When
|
|
** ready, finally this handle can be issued on any [BusTerm].

/**
|
|
* A concrete command invocation in the state of preparation and argument binding.
|
|
* This value object is a tracking handle used within the UI to deal with establishing
|
|
* a command context, maybe to present the command within a menu or to picking up
|
|
* actual invocation parameters from the context.
|
|
* @remarks typically you don't create an InvocationTrail from scratch; rather
|
|
* you'll find it embedded into rules placed into a [InteractionStateManager].
|
|
* The intention is to define it alongside with the command prototype.
|
|
*/
|
|
class InvocationTrail
|
|
{
|
|
string cmdID_;
|
|
|
|
public:
|
|
/**
|
|
* Build a "command-as-prepared-for-UI".
|
|
* @param prototype an _already existing_ command prototype definition within Proc-Layer
|
|
* @remarks we deliberately link InvocationTrail to the existence of an actual prototype.
|
|
* Invocation trails will be created in advance for various scenarios to invoke commands,
|
|
* and are in fact lightweight placeholder handles -- so we do not want placeholders to
|
|
* exist somewhere in the system and IDs to be sent over the bus, without the certainty
|
|
* of a real invocation site and a matching command operation to exist somewhere else
|
|
* within the system.
|
|
*/
